REMOVAL
000415
WARNING
Allow hydraulic system to cool before performing procedure. Hot hydraulic fluid can cause
severe burns. Wear eye, hand, and skin protection when working with heated parts.
Hydraulic oil is very slippery. Immediately wipe up any spills. Failure to follow this warning
may result in injury or death to personnel.
CAUTION
Plug and cap all hydraulic hoses and fittings to prevent contamination.
NOTE
Tag and mark hydraulic hoses to aid in installation.
Note routing and location of hydraulic hoses to aid in installation.
1. Remove four bolts (Figure 1, Item 1), washers (Figure 1, Item 6), two flange halves (Figure 1, Item 4),
and hydraulic hose (Figure 1, Item 2) from rear main control valve (Figure 1, Item 5).
2. Remove O-ring (Figure 1, Item 3) from hydraulic hose (Figure 1, Item 2). Discard O-ring.
